Cosmic Event: Cosmogonic activation: Brahmā petitions Śiva for jagat-sṛṣṭi and vivṛddhi; śakti differentiates and emanation occurs from the brow-space.
It presents creation as proceeding through Śiva’s will and Śivā’s manifest power (Śakti), showing that cosmic origination and growth occur when the transcendent Lord is invoked and the divine energy becomes expressible in form.
It supports Saguna worship by indicating that, though Śiva is supreme, the universe becomes knowable through manifestation—Śiva with Śakti—so Linga worship reveres the formless Lord as present and operative within creation.
